文档解释
ORA-24157: duplicate variable name string
Cause: there is a variable of the same name in the evaluation context
Action: do not add two variables of the same name to an evaluation context
ORA-24157错误表示已经存在相同名称的字符串变量。它发生在用户尝试使用Oracle数据库中的存储过程或函数时。
官方解释
ORA-24157:duplicate variable name string
该消息指示重复变量名string。
常见案例
ORA-24157错误在使用Oracle数据库中的存储过程或函数时可能会发生。 在指定存储过程形参时,用户将不小心指定两个具有相同名称的输入参数,从而导致ORA-24157错误,该错误指示存在重复变量名。
一般处理方法及步骤
为了解决ORA-24157错误,用户必须重新查看指定存储过程的参数列表,并检查是否存在两个具有相同名称的参数。 或者,用户可以更改重复的变量名,以便指向正确的变量,这样Oracle数据库才能成功执行存储过程,而不会抛出ORA-24157错误。